WebTell your healthcare provider (HCP) if you develop severe pain or fever shortly after placement, miss a period, have abdominal pain, or if Paragard comes out. If it comes out, use backup birth control. Tell your HCP you have Paragard before having an MRI or a medical procedure using heat therapy. WebParagard placement is non-surgical and done by a healthcare provider during a routine office visit. WebMar 1, 2024 · Next, your health care provider will fold down ParaGard's horizontal arms and place the device inside an applicator tube. The tube is inserted into your cervical canal and ParaGard is carefully placed in your uterus.
